It likely exploded because they blew it up (flight termination system). It looks like the stages failed to separate and it started to spin. In this case they don’t let an uncontrollable rocket just fly off and see where it comes down, they blow it up. The FTS is basically an explosive mounted to the rocket that can be remotely detonated exactly for situations like this.
The altitude and velocity when things went sideways were in MRBM territory, not ICBM territory so the only thing they would have hit would have been the Atlantic ocean.

That sounds logical, but isn't really a thing in aerospace/space. Complicated high-energy systems have thousands of failure points. So to have any chance of success each failure point needs to be engineered below, by way of example, a 0.0001% chance of failure. That costs lots of money. But say one decides to accept more risk for less cost. Ok. So you switch from 0.0001 to 0.001 failure rates. You risk is now 10-fold higher at each failure point, but with thousands of failure points adding up you are now essentially doomed. And you haven't saved anything. The cost of 0.001 components isn't fundamentally different than the 0.0001 components were. SpaceX can save money though different business practices, by trimming people/money/contracts/compliance and such, but if you look at their rockets they are not fundamentally any less-perfect than anyone else's. They cannot afford to be. This is why rocket failures, like aircraft failures, are taken so seriously. There is an extremely fine line between "works ever time" and "never worked twice" with very little money to be saved between the two.
Across many areas, risk-v-cost math never really happens. It is either go or no go. Take CPU production. Intel spends billions at each of hundreds of fabrication step to push down miniscule error rates because any of a million errors can destroy a chip. There is no money to be saved by allowing any one process to become less than as perfect as it can possibly be. A detected slip from 0.0001 to 0.001 at any step would result in an entire fab being shut down in order to diagnose the problem. The marginal savings of a less-than-perfect process isn't worth the exponential increase in the risk of total system failure.
